A Modern and Human-Centered Health Communication Initiative
Since its launch on July 9, 2025, VTV Live Healthy has been praised by the Ministry of Health as a creative, modern, and strategic initiative adheres to the Party and State’s directives and the health sector’s communication strategy. In an era where misinformation can easily spread on social media, the program plays an essential role by delivering verified health information from leading doctors and medical experts.
Each episode of VTV Live Healthy is carefully structured with diverse segments, ranging from domestic and international health updates to in-depth features on specific health topics. Key sections include “Bac si oi” (Doctor, Please!), offering live consultations from the studio, and “Vong tay y te” (Healthcare Embrace), which connects patients in difficult circumstances with the compassionate support of the community.

The program also features engaging mini-segments such as “Gia ma biet truoc” (If Only We Knew Earlier), “Suc khoe tu goc” (Health from the Roots), “Y hoc tuoi vang” (Golden Age Medicine), and “Cong nghe cho su song” (Technology for Life), helping audiences gain deeper insights into medical knowledge and modern healthcare approaches. Complex topics are delivered in an engaging and accessible format through reports, interactive sessions, and real-life scenarios.
The show also regularly airs instructional clips on basic medical skills, first aid, and accident prevention in daily life to help viewers respond proactively and protect their health effectively.
